Comprehending Registered Agent Solutions Licensed representative solutions serve a critical role in the judicial structure of a business organization. They serve as the source of contact between the business and the state, collecting essential legal documents, such as service of process notices, tax forms, and compliance papers. This ensures that businesses can operate smoothly without the disruption of overlooking a key legal document. Adherence and Legal Obligations Navigating the regulatory landscape can be daunting for companies, and understanding adherence and regulatory duties is vital for maintaining a positive status. Registered agents play a critical role in guaranteeing that your business complies with state regulations by acting as the official point of communication for legal documents and government communications. They aid confirm that any alerts, including lawsuits and compliance reminders, are delivered promptly and correctly. Besides receiving official notifications, designated representatives are responsible for maintaining a designated workspace. This office must stay open during standard working hours, providing a reliable location for legal delivery. Noncompliance to meet these obligations can lead to significant repercussions, including the potential loss of good standing or even unfavorable rulings in a court case. Another important advantage is the anonymity that designated representatives provide. Hiring a registered representative service allows business owners to keep their personal locations off public documents. This is particularly advantageous for home-based companies or founders who wish to preserve confidentiality. A dependable authorized agent acts as the formal point of contact, guarding entrepreneur owners from unsolicited inquiries and improving their enterprise privacy. Modifying or Renewing Your Designated Agent Modifying or updating your registered agent is a crucial aspect of maintaining your business's adherence and legal standing. A designated agent serves as the point of contact for legal documents and formal correspondence. If your business is experiencing changes, whether due to moving or unhappiness with your current agent, it is essential to initiate the change process without delay. Most states mandate that the new registered agent meet certain requirements, such as possessing a physical address in the state of registration and being available during business hours. The procedure of modifying or renewing your designated agent typically involves submitting a form to the appropriate state agency, along with any necessary fees. This may be done via the web, through postal service, or in person, depending on state regulations. Be sure to confirm that your new registered agent is aware of their duties and prepared to handle your business's needs. Properly overseeing this transition helps preserve your business's statutory obligations and reduces any chance of missed legal notifications.
